Which of the following Indian states was annexed by Lord Dalhousie on the pretext of mal-administration?

  1. Udaipur

  2. Oudh

  3. Nagpur

  4. None of these

Reveal answer Fill a bubble to check yourself
B Correct answer
Explanation

Oudh (Awadh) was annexed by Lord Dalhousie in 1856 using the Doctrine of Lapse, with the official pretext being misadministration and maladministration. The annexation was controversial as Nawab Wajid Ali Shah was accused of misgovernance, but the real motives were strategic control and the region's wealth.
